Output eca9315c64e5239521d1afd56411f6958252aca12bbb30d3e1f35a99906f9360:24

value
129038253
script pubkey
OP_0 OP_PUSHBYTES_32 8c79072dfd2eb86cecc93d44085d0220377f26b42ffd16f34e4cd7d5a41f84c2
address
bc1q33uswt0a96uxemxf84zqshgzyqmh7f459l73du6wfntatfqlsnpqs562uh
transaction
eca9315c64e5239521d1afd56411f6958252aca12bbb30d3e1f35a99906f9360
spent
true